Hi

Great responses to last weekend's challenge. I had an image lined up for this week but decided to keep that for a future week and try something different this weekend.

The two characters below were created in Adobe Fuse, saved to the library then rendered against a transparent background in Photoshop and saved as a PNG with transparency. So no need for complex masking (I must be getting soft ). If you have not used Fuse I'd recommend you give it a try - it's a lot of fun.

So the challenge this week is to take one, or both of the characters below, put them in a scene that tells us a bit of a story.

Anything goes as long as it meets the forum rules on decency, copyright etc (so keep it clean ).

Anyone is welcome to have a go - whether you are a complete beginner or a Photoshop expert.

There are no prizes - just the chance to practice, show off, or bring a bit of humour and fun.

When posting back your edited images please use jpeg and downsize to 1200px on the long side. 

To download the image below without the forum scaling artifacts, right click and Save Image As / Save Picture As (or similar depending on your browser).
